Taxonomic Classification

Rank Campbells Meerkatze Kolumbianischer Nachtaffe
Kingdom same Animalia (Tier) Animalia (Tier)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ordatiere) Chordata (Chordatiere)
Class same Mammalia (Säugetiere) Mammalia (Säugetiere)
Order same Primates (Primaten) Primates (Primaten)
Family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) Aotidae
Genus Cercopithecus Aotus
Species Cercopithecus campbelli Aotus lemurinus

Evolutionary Relationship

Campbells Meerkatze and Kolumbianischer Nachtaffe share a common ancestor at the Order level: Primates. (Primaten)
